Meng Cheng is a scholar working on Management Science and Operations Research, Management Information Systems and Automotive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Meng Cheng has authored 14 papers receiving a total of 345 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Management Science and Operations Research, 6 papers in Management Information Systems and 6 papers in Automotive Engineering. Recurrent topics in Meng Cheng’s work include Auction Theory and Applications (9 papers), Supply Chain and Inventory Management (6 papers) and Transportation and Mobility Innovations (6 papers). Meng Cheng is often cited by papers focused on Auction Theory and Applications (9 papers), Supply Chain and Inventory Management (6 papers) and Transportation and Mobility Innovations (6 papers). Meng Cheng collaborates with scholars based in Hong Kong, China and Türkiye. Meng Cheng's co-authors include Su Xiu Xu, George Q. Huang, Xiang T.R. Kong, Hai Yang, Ray Y. Zhong, Yue Zhai, Kai Kang, Jianghong Feng, Zhaohua Wang and Eren İnci and has published in prestigious journals such as European Journal of Operational Research, Mathematics of Computation and International Journal of Production Research.
